Wastewater filtering from a metal polishing station for pollution prevention.

Wastewater effluent from grinding and polishing stations is a pollution concern at Sandia National Laboratories. Efforts to ensure that the effluent does not exceed City of Albuquerque grab sample limits have relied on traps and settling tanks which are ineffective, As an alternative measure, a pumped filtration system was tested to determine if metal concentrations in wastewater could be reduced to a level below the City of Albuquerque grab sample limits. A one micron cellulose filter was used in a commercial filtration pump to filter wastewater. Wastewater samples were taken from upstream and downstream of the filter during typical polishing operations, and the samples analyzed for seven different metal concentrations. The concentrations of metal in the wastewater after filtration were always below the City of Albuquerque discharge limits, sometimes by 2 orders of magnitude. This method of pollution prevention (ie. wastewater filtering) is both inexpensive and very efficient. Sandia National Laboratories facilities designers in combination with facilities maintenance personnel are currently retrofitting existing stations in the Metallography laboratory in Department 1822 and should consider installing this type of system with all new polishing facilities.
